HEAR YE! HEAR YE!


All-Filipino Haiku Contest

The Embassy of Japan and the Graduate School of the University of Santo Tomas invite Filipino citizens living in Japan or abroad to join the HAIKU CONTEST in commemoration of the Philippines-Japan Friendship Year 2006. The theme is: "Pinoy Haiku: Verses for Mother Nature". Details and forms are available at the Embassy of Japan, or better yet, check them out here.

Applications for the next LIRA Workshop are now being accepted. Applicants are invited to submit five (5) poems in Filipino along with a short bio-data and one 2x2 ID picture to LIRA Workshop c/o Dir. Vim Nadera, UP Institute of Creative Writing, 2/F Bulwagang Rizal, UP Diliman, 1101 Quezon City.


National Artist for Literature Dean Virgilio Almario

Requirements can also be sent to lira_makata@yahoo.com or to liraworkshop@gmail.com. The workshop will be held every Saturday and Sunday this June and July at the College of Arts and Letter in University of the Philippines, Diliman. National Artist for Literature Virgilio S. Almario will direct the workshop.
